Aps6 clinician

Darwin
Hudson RPO
Posted: 26 April
Offer description

Position Overview

Make a real difference supporting clients with complex needs through meaningful, one‐to‐one clinical work. Stability plus flexibility with a secure 2‐year labour hire contract and a competitive hourly rate. Grow your career with diverse clinical experience, professional development and supportive leadership.

Responsibilities

* Provide high‐quality, evidence‐informed clinical services including risk management, brief intervention, care coordination, and referrals for clients with complex or multiple needs.
* Maintain accurate, confidential client files including progress notes, care plans, risk assessments and case updates.
* Build collaborative relationships with government agencies, community mental health services, ex‐service organisations and welfare providers.
* Contribute to a recovery‐focused, stepped‐care model through strong stakeholder engagement.
* Participate in case reviews and meetings to ensure coordinated and clinically appropriate support.
* Maintain professional registration through ongoing CPD and clinical supervision.
* Ensure practice aligns with legislation, risk procedures, and organisational policies.
* Work with leadership to review and manage complex cases.
* Support additional organisational needs such as:
o Co‐facilitating group programs
o Community development and service‐promotion activities
o Program evaluation, research, and quality improvement
o Providing quality assurance for contracted clinicians
o Managing intake queues and coordinating service allocation
o Conducting intake assessments to inform service pathways

Qualifications

* Strong interpersonal and communication skills
* Competence in trauma‐informed, holistic assessment and brief intervention
* High‐level written and verbal communication
* Sound judgement and capacity to respond to critical incidents
* Confidence using client management systems and digital tools

Mandatory Requirements

* Working with Vulnerable People registration, or
* Working with Children Check

Preferred Qualifications

* Registered Psychologist, Occupational Therapist or Registered Nurse (AHPRA)
* Qualified Social Worker (AASW)
* Masters‐level Counsellor registered with PACFA (Clinical) or ACA Level 3/4

Benefits

* Make a real and lasting difference
* Work in a supportive, values‐driven environment
* Engage in diverse, meaningful clinical work
* Benefit from a secure 2‐year labour hire contract
* Earn a competitive hourly rate: $65.03 – $73.85 + super
